Executive Assistant(at the rank of Clerk II) in the Faculty of Dentistry (Ref.: 534469)

We are looking for an Executive Assistant (at the rank of Clerk II) to join the Faculty of Dentistry.

The Role

The appointee will provide administrative and clerical support to the Faculty Office, in the areas of research postgraduate education and central administration.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Programme admissions, examination and student matters
  • Logistics support for workshops, seminars and events
  • Administrative and clerical support to the general office and
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ications and Qualities

  • A Bachelor's degree OR a Higher Diploma or an Associate Degree with 3 years relevant work experience, preferably in tertiary institutions or in the education sector
  • Good IT proficiency, including MS Word and MS Excel
  • Attention to details
  • A strong sense of responsibility, good problem-solving abilities and interpersonal skills
  • Self-motivated and able to work both independently and collaboratively in a team and
  • Ability to prioritize multiple tasks to meet tight deadlines.

What We Offer

The appointment will be made on fixed-term full-time contract for 2 years, to commence as soon as possible with the possibility of renewal subject to satisfactory performance. A highly competitive salary commensurate with qualifications and experience will be offered, together with contract-end gratuity and University contribution to a retirement benefits scheme at 10% of basic salary. Other benefits include annual leave and medical benefits.

How to Apply

The University only accepts online application for the above post. Applicants should apply online and upload an up-to-date CV. Closes February 25, 2026. Shortlisted candidates will be invited to attend a written test and an interview.

The University of Hong Kong is a public research university in Hong Kong. Founded in 1887 as the Hong Kong College of Medicine for Chinese, it is the oldest tertiary institution in Hong Kong. HKU was also the first university established by the British in East Asia.
